This enables the TCAT Commissioner to receive data such as TLS Alerts, or asynchronously sent 'event' TLVs, over TLS. Processing TLS Alert is required to detect the sending of Alert by the TCAT Device, which is a requirement to be verified in cert tests. An async background process is started to receive and log the received events. Also some minor improvements in connection state management: when certain commands are given after the TCAT link is disconnected, or when a TCAT link could not be established, a message will be printed to clearly say it's disconnected, instead of a cryptic error. Error messages are now clearly prefixed with 'Error:'. The CA certificate store for CommCert3 is extended with an additional CA certificate, so that it can be verified in cert tests that a TCAT Device rejects a wrong Commissioner with a TLS Alert (previously this couldn't be tested). Also includes a fix of the pyproject.toml such that Poetry does not display the long warning on installation. Also includes an improvement of TLV displaying to the user with a STRING field, if the value is a string. Also includes some syntax fixes that were flagged by the IDE, such as missing return types for methods, or member variables that were not initialized in the __init__().
